### Step 4: Reconfigure the grid solver

After upgrading Wordloom to the new lattice engine, the crossword generator no longer reads its legacy INI file. Delete it to avoid confusion — the engine will silently prefer it if present, producing stale grids. All tuning now lives in the central config store. Set the following values exactly as shown below.

deployment values, kajep-kageg:
[praix]
host = praix.paliqcorp.corp
user = praix_svc
database = praix_prod

# Build Provenance — Duskmill Backfill Scheduler

The Duskmill scheduler runs nightly data backfills for the Harrowgate warehouse. All images are built in the sealed Fenwick pipeline; no manual pushes are permitted. Attestations are signed at build time and verified before each run. Dependency pins are audited quarterly. The current production image's trace token follows.

pipeline stamp: htk9_ce63042d9

**Q: I'm a contractor — what happens at the front desk?**

Sign in at the Harlowe Point lobby. State your site contact's name. No contact named, no entry. Wear the visitor lanyard visibly at all times. Lost lanyards cost a replacement fee. Escorts required beyond the lobby until your induction is complete. Returning the same week? You can skip the induction video. Enter through the inner turnstile using the code below.

staff pass of kawip-hawef = bdg-QLP-2

# Greenhouse controller env — Fernholt Bay site.
# On-call: the CO2 and humidity probes on bench rows 3–7 drift upward after
# roughly 14 days of continuous operation. DRIFT_CORRECTION_WINDOW=14d applies
# a rolling recalibration; do not shorten it below 7d or the controller will
# overcorrect and the vents will oscillate. Recalibration pulls reference
# curves from the Spirelight calibration service, which requires the access
# credential set on the next line.

secret setting of hawep-yahig: LEDGER_TOKEN29=41b5d6315371c92885eaeb077fb63

Ticket: Signature verification failure on Wavecrest preview bundle

During last night's deploy of Wavecrest, the audio waveform preview service, the Mirefold gateway rejected build 4.1.0 with a signature mismatch. The artifact hash matches CI output, so we suspect the bundle was signed with the retired key. For the security review, the currently authorized signing key is reproduced below.

release key, kagaf-tahop: bky6_tFmur5